Transaction

11bd79be16d5fdbb53326fa818bf33e47c26dd52fa2d4754071685fbfb97136a
399,147 confirmations
Timestamp
1537122015
Block541,697
Fee17,203 sats
Fee rate30.7 sats/vB
view on mempool.space

Inputs & Outputs